Anders Kissmeyer is a much larger name in the rest of the world than he is in his own country. This will be reflected in a number of collaboration brews. Beers he brews in collaboration with his large network of friends among the best international brewmasters. To fully unfold our ambitions, we have chosen to present all of the KISSMEYER beers in a number of distinct portfolios, each with a conceptual idea of it’s own.
'Kissmeyer Beer and Brewing’ is my company, launched in 2010 after I ended my 10 year carreer with Nørrebro Bryghus. Longue description The company spans over three main areas of business - ’Kissmeyer Beer’ is my beer brand offering my own and collaborative beers at home and abroad. ’Kissmeyer Brewing’ is my consultancy business offering services related mainly to the brewing industry. Finally, under the collective name ’Kissmeyer Beer & Brewing’ I offer a wide range of communication services incl. beer tastings and presentations

Pours dark copper with a large, lasting head.Nose shows nutty malt, caramel, golden syrup, soft spicy hops and brown sugar. Pretty rich and moreish.Similar rich flavours, lots of nutty malt and caramel followed by spicy hops and an assertive bitterness.Body seems a bit thick, and there’s not enough carbonation.Not too much of a hop presence, but enjoyable nonetheless.

0.5l bottle @ Patricks, Kristiansand. A blurry dark copper-ish beer with a big and lasting off-white head. Nice lacing on this. On the aroma this one has candy tones, fruity hops, caramel and it's quite fresh and almost zesty as well. A bit thin - almost watery texture and the carbonation level is comfortably average to soft. Nice flavors, perhaps a tad sweet and it's really fruity! Hints of fruity citrus plants all the way. I would describe it as very easy to drink little of, but not great to drink a whole lot of. Really low bitterness all the way, and perhaps not utterly exciting, but I found it quite tasty. Just what I needed now. 30.03.2012
